gulpfiile.js文件调试方法(包括需要输命令行参数才能运行的代码)
gulpfiile.js文件调试方法
有时候我们会有这样的需求:
想要在gulpfile文件内进行断点调试,但是gulpfile的运行是依靠命令行参数:gulp build来运行的,而如果我们直接F5进行调试,会发现断点根本断不住,因为没有参数,该js文件直接就执行到底结束了。所以这种情况我们就得修改调试的launch.json文件来进行调试。
launch.json文件是js文件调试的必需文件,当我们按F5之后会自动生成,只需要修改其中的参数便能实现以上的需求。
需要注意的几个参数是:
program:这里必需得填对,要定位到bin中的gulp.js文件才行
args:即为你想要执行的任务,这是一个数组,如有后续的参数可以再填入到后面
cwd:当前工程目录
这样就大功告成啦~